Resumo: Biomass is a renewable resource that is increasingly being used as an energy source. This dissertation aimed to study the economic viability of using biomass for power generation. In Chapter 1, the contributions of renewable energy to sustainable energy production were studied. In addition, the types of solid biomass were addressed and what are the main parameters used to make their energy characterization. In Chapter 2, was studied the biomass market in the State of São Paulo and also the energy properties of the biomass analyzed: sugarcane bagasse, briquette, sawdust, firewood and eucalyptus forest, pine chips, charcoal and rice husks. In Chapter 3, an economical-energetic analysis was made on the following biomass destined for burning in the Sorocaba Metropolitan Region (RMS): briquette, sawdust, chips, firewood and eucalyptus forest and rice husk. In this chapter, the cost of energy, logistics, and price were analyzed. Finally, Chapter 4 gives a general conclusion of the work and also discusses the limitations and recommendations for future work. From the analysis of the results obtained in chapter 2, it was seen that there are more suppliers of firewood, wood chips and eucalyptus forest and the biggest demand for these biomasses are the sectors of food and beverages, furniture, red ceramics and paper and cellulose in the State of São Paulo. In relation to supply, the materials that have the highest production in this state are sugarcane bagasse, the eucalyptus forest and firewood and the pine forest. In the energy analysis, it was found that charcoal, wood, briquette, wood chips and eucalyptus wood and wood chips are more suitable for burning. In chapter 3, it was found that the biomasses that showed technical and economic feasibility to be used in the RMS were the chip and the eucalyptus log for several distance radii.

Esta dissertação teve como objetivo geral estudar a viabilidade econômica do uso de biomassa para geração de energia. No capítulo 1 foi estudada as contribuições das energias renováveis para a produção de energia de forma sustentável. Além disso, foram abordados os tipos de biomassa sólida e quais são os principais parâmetros utilizados para fazer sua caracterização energética. No capítulo 2 foram estudados o mercado de biomassa no Estado de São Paulo e também as propriedades energéticas das biomassas analisadas: bagaço de cana, briquete, serragem, lenha e floresta de eucalipto, cavaco de pinus, carvão vegetal e casca de arroz. No capítulo 3 foi feita uma análise econômico-energética sobre as seguintes biomassas destinadas para queima na Região Metropolitana de Sorocaba (RMS): briquete, serragem, cavaco, lenha e floresta de eucalipto e casca de arroz. Neste capítulo, foram analisados o custo de energia, a logística, e o preço. Por fim, o capítulo 4 faz uma conclusão geral do trabalho e também aborda as limitações e recomendações para trabalhos futuros. A partir da análise realizada no capítulo 2, foi visto que existem mais fornecedores de lenha, cavaco e floresta de eucalipto e os maiores demandantes destas biomassas são os setores de alimentos e bebidas, moveleiro, de cerâmica vermelha e de papel e celulose no Estado de São Paulo. Em relação à oferta, os materiais que possuem maior produção neste estado são o bagaço de cana, a floresta e a lenha de eucalipto e a floresta de pinus. Na análise energética, constatou-se que o carvão vegetal, a madeira, o briquete, o cavaco e a lenha de eucalipto e o cavaco de pinus são mais apropriados para queima.
